[GH-ISSUE #6942] [Bug] After creation, toggle headings appear not editable #3071

Closed
opened 2026-03-23 21:27:23 +00:00 by mirror · 1 comment
Owner

Originally created by @dandv on GitHub (Dec 8, 2024).
Original GitHub issue: https://github.com/AppFlowy-IO/AppFlowy/issues/6942

Originally assigned to: @LucasXu0 on GitHub.

Bug Description

Toggle headings behave in surprising ways vs. Notion.

How to Reproduce

  1. Create a toggle heading
  2. Click in it, or at the end (e.g. to change "Heading 1" to "Heading for my thesis")
  3. The cursor is placed at the beginning of the heading, and the heading looks greyed out, as if not editable

Expected Behavior

Like Notion's. See https://en.wikipedia.org/wiki/Principle_of_least_astonishment

Operating System

Linux

AppFlowy Version(s)

0.7.6

Screenshots

image

Additional Context

I've just downloaded the Appimage a few minutes ago and ran into this bug. Toggle lists (#1078) are the main feature of Notion that prevent me from switching.

Originally created by @dandv on GitHub (Dec 8, 2024). Original GitHub issue: https://github.com/AppFlowy-IO/AppFlowy/issues/6942 Originally assigned to: @LucasXu0 on GitHub. ### Bug Description Toggle headings behave in surprising ways vs. Notion. ### How to Reproduce 1. Create a toggle heading 2. Click in it, or at the end (e.g. to change "Heading 1" to "Heading for my thesis") 3. The cursor is placed at the beginning of the heading, and the heading looks greyed out, as if not editable ### Expected Behavior Like Notion's. See https://en.wikipedia.org/wiki/Principle_of_least_astonishment ### Operating System Linux ### AppFlowy Version(s) 0.7.6 ### Screenshots ![image](https://github.com/user-attachments/assets/a503e1ec-7211-4bd2-b616-c34885d19ad2) ### Additional Context I've just downloaded the Appimage a few minutes ago and ran into this bug. Toggle lists (#1078) are the main feature of Notion that prevent me from switching.
Author
Owner

@LucasXu0 commented on GitHub (Dec 9, 2024):

Hi, @dandv. The 'Heading 1' in your screenshot is the placeholder which appears in grey color, and while the arrow icon may look small, we have expanded its hit test area.

Screenshot 2024-12-09 at 09 31 55
<!-- gh-comment-id:2526600028 --> @LucasXu0 commented on GitHub (Dec 9, 2024): Hi, @dandv. The 'Heading 1' in your screenshot is the placeholder which appears in grey color, and while the arrow icon may look small, we have expanded its hit test area. <img width="691" alt="Screenshot 2024-12-09 at 09 31 55" src="https://github.com/user-attachments/assets/adf61216-3fa3-4929-9581-f7ed61d0fa9a">
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
AppFlowy-IO/AppFlowy#3071
No description provided.